integrate login/register functionality more properly with app
[scpubgit/stemmaweb.git] / root / css / style.css
CommitLineData
fb6e49b3 1/* General site-wide layout */
b8a92065 2body {
3 margin: 0;
4 padding: 20px;
5 font: 1em Arial, Helvetica, sans-serif;
6 font-size: 85%;
7 color: #666;
8}
fb6e49b3 9h1 {
10 border-bottom: 1px solid #488dd2;
11 color: #488dd2;
12 font-size: 24px;
13 font-weight: 100;
14 margin: 0 0 17px;
15 padding: 0;
16 width: 650px;
17}
18h2 {
fb792f63 19 margin-top: 10px;
20 color: #488dd2;
21 font-size: 18px;
fb6e49b3 22}
fb792f63 23h3 {
24 color: #488dd2;
25 font-size: 14px;
26 font-style: italic;
27}
fb6e49b3 28
f007ac1e 29div.button {
30 background: transparent url('../images/b_button_a.png') no-repeat scroll top right;
31 color: #fff;
32 display: block;
33 float: left;
34 font: normal 12px Times, Times New Roman, Serif; /* arial, sans-serif; */
35 height: 24px;
36 margin-right: 6px;
37 padding-right: 18px; /* sliding doors padding */
38 text-decoration: none;
39}
40div.button.reset {
41 background: transparent url('../images/c_button_a.png') no-repeat scroll top right;
42}
43div.button span {
44 background: transparent url('../images/b_button_span.png') no-repeat;
45 display: block;
46 line-height: 14px;
47 padding: 5px 0 5px 18px;
48}
49div.button.reset span {
50 background: transparent url('../images/c_button_span.png') no-repeat;
51}
52div.button:hover {
53 background-position: bottom right;
54 color: #444;
55 outline: none; /* hide dotted outline in Firefox */
56}
57div.button:hover span {
58 background-position: bottom left;
59}
60
eb38afbc 61#topbanner {
62 width: 100%;
63 height: 100px;
64 margin-top: 20px;
65}
66#bannerinfo {
67 float: right;
68 margin-right: 12%;
69 margin-top: 15px;
70}
71.navlink {
72 color: #488dd2;
73 text-decoration: underline;
74}
75
76
f007ac1e 77
fb6e49b3 78/* Index page components */
79
fb792f63 80#directory_container {
fb6e49b3 81 float: left;
82 width: 300px;
83 height: 450px;
84 border: 1px #c6dcf1 solid;
85}
fb792f63 86#directory {
f007ac1e 87 margin-left: 10px;
fb792f63 88}
62723740 89.traditionname {
90 text-decoration: underline;
91}
92.selected {
93 font-style: italic;
94}
7439e248 95.mainnav {
96 position: absolute;
97 top: 10px;
98 right: 80px;
99 font-size: 14px;
100 font-weight: 100;
101 color: #488dd2;
102}
103.mainnav a {
104 color: #488dd2;
105}
f007ac1e 106#variant_container {
fb6e49b3 107 clear: both;
fb6e49b3 108 height: 400px;
f007ac1e 109 padding-top: 20px;
110}
111#variant_graph {
112 /* width: 900px; */
25d07c77 113 height: 350px;
f007ac1e 114 clear: both;
5ba6c2b4 115 overflow: auto;
62723740 116 text-align: center;
117}
118#variant_graph img {
119 margin-top: expression(( 400 - this.height ) / 2);
fb6e49b3 120}
f007ac1e 121#stemma_container {
122 float: left;
123 height: 450px;
124 margin-left: 40px;
125}
126#stemma_container h2 h3 {
127 color: #666;
128}
fb6e49b3 129#stemma_graph {
f007ac1e 130 height: 375px;
b8a92065 131 width: 500px;
62723740 132 text-align: center;
f007ac1e 133 border: 1px #c6dcf1 solid;
62723740 134}
135#stemma_graph img {
136 margin-top: expression(( 450 - this.height ) / 2);
b8a92065 137}
f007ac1e 138#stexaminer_button {
139 bottom: 0;
f79dd72c 140 margin-top: 13px;
b8a92065 141}
f007ac1e 142#relater_button {
143 float: left;
f79dd72c 144 margin-left: 100px;
b8a92065 145}